
1 an emotion excited by what is unexpected, unfamiliar, or inexplicable, esp. surprise mingled with admiration or curiosity etc. 2 a strange or remarkable person or thing, specimen, event etc. 3 having marvellous or amazing properties etc. OED

Tuesday, 9 August 2011


Performance Research in the River Frome

Collaboration with Itta Howie